Decoding Vanity Phone Numbers: Are They Worth It?

Vanity phone numbers have gained more info a certain allure for businesses and individuals alike. These catchy, memorable digits often showcase your brand name or slogan, making them instantly recognizable and potentially boosting your standing. But are they actually worth the extra investment? While vanity numbers can definitely enhance your branding, it's important to weigh the perks against the potential cons.

One of the main arguments in favor of vanity numbers is their ability to enhance customer memory. A memorable number can easily be passed around, leading to increased brand visibility. Furthermore, vanity numbers can bring a touch of elegance to your business, projecting an image of prosperity.

  • On the other hand, it's important to consider that vanity numbers can be substantially more pricey than traditional phone numbers. You may also need to investigate different area codes and number combinations to find a truly desirable option, which can be a time-consuming procedure.
  • In conclusion, the decision of whether or not to invest in a vanity phone number is a unique one that depends on your specific requirements and budget. Carefully consider the potential benefits and drawbacks before making your choice.

Advantages and Disadvantages of Vanity Phone Numbers Exposed

Vanity phone numbers have long been a desired tool for businesses looking to create a memorable image. These digits often feature catchy combinations that showcase a company's name or slogan, making them easy to remember and promote. However, as with any promotional strategy, vanity phone numbers come with both pros and drawbacks.

One of the primary advantages of vanity phone numbers is their ability to improve brand recognition. A memorable number can make it more convenient for customers to call your business, while also solidifying your brand's presence in the market. Moreover, vanity numbers can be used to draw specific customer segments by using keywords or phrases that connect with their interests.

  • On the other hand, it's important to weigh the potential disadvantages of vanity phone numbers. They can be pricey to acquire and maintain. Additionally, there is no guarantee that a vanity number will automatically boost business.
  • In conclusion, the decision of whether or not to use a vanity phone number should be based on a careful evaluation of your organization's specific requirements. If you have the resources and believe a vanity number will help your brand, then it may be a valuable investment.
